Did you also know that you can get some amazing nail polishes at the store Urban Outfitters?! Like many clothing retailers, Urban Outfitters carries a line of store brand nail polish. They come in a variety of colors and types, and even go on clearance for amazing prices! Let me show you some of my favorite polishes from Urban Outfitters.



First up is Bright Lights, a milky white polish with multi-colored hexagonal glitter. Bright Lights has a great but sheer formula. I applied three coats in the photos above, and it is not fully opaque. I really like the look I achieved, but if you would like opacity just layer a coat over a white nail polish. Bright Lights reminds me of an indie nail polish, but it was so much more affordable (even though I love my indies!). I love that Urban Outfitters keeps up with the nail polish trends!



Next up is Sunshine, a golden yellow creme polish. Sunshine has a good formula, especially for a yellow polish! It is opaque in two coats, but I added a third to make sure there were no visible streaks. Sunshine is a great polish for the fall, and can go well with many outfits, especially those olive green tones. I definitely suggest Sunshine if you're looking for a great yellow! 



 Last but not least is Scorcher, a glitter top coat with fine silver glitter and a mix of multi-colored hexagonal glitter. I layered one coat over another Urban Outfitters polish called Freakin' Pink that I featured in THIS blog post. Scorcher is an amazing glitter polish -- the coverage is great and the glitters apply with ease. I just love glitter top coats, and Scorcher is no exception!

All in all, I love the variety of nail polishes that can be found at Urban Outfitters! Not only are they awesome polishes, but they retail for just $5 each or 2 for $8!
